Cancer IRL

By: Desiree Deleau and Iva Golubovic
  • Summary

  • Being in your 20s or 30s and having cancer means sometimes you Google your symptoms and end up being right about the self diagnosis. It means your career might be going on pause, it means you may need to speak to your partner about kids a lot sooner than you thought. It means you will likely need to develop a great sense of humour. It means you may need to reevaluate your friendships. It means a lot of things, and not all of them are discussed, understood, nor treatable in a doctor's office. This is a podcast about all of those things, in conversation with people who have gone through them, or love someone who has.

  • Breast Cancer IRL
    Aug 6 2023
    Diana unfortunately wasn’t new to the cancer world, having watched her best friend go through cancer at an early age. Going through it herself she was prepared to advocate for her treatment and to make space for the isolation and the community that ebbs and flows through a cancer journey. We discuss the honest truth when it comes to what it feels like to have cancer both physically and mentally.

  • Testicular Cancer IRL
    Jul 31 2023
    Danny is a content creator and avid streamer. He stepped into the streaming world just as his cancer journey began, and created his own community and outpost for the support and structure he needed. He also speaks to his off line community of friends, family, and various clients whose continued support allowed him to pick up where he left off once his medical treatments were behind him.

  • Blood Cancer IRL [Leukemia]
    Jul 23 2023

    Michelle’s heavy periods were dismissed as just that. It was only after advocating for herself and getting screened that her treatments avalanched. She walks us through the medical world of Leukemia, and the her emotional journey which she shared with her partner, tight knit family, and the LA creative community.
